Inspiratory Muscle Training Post-Liver Transplant

Liver Disease ChronicMuscle Weakness1 more

Individuals with chronic liver disease develop significant muscle wasting that remains post-liver transplant. The transplant surgery additionally challenges respiratory mechanics. Respiratory muscle strength has been measured to be impaired in individuals post liver transplant. This study proposes an 8 week intervention designed to increase respiratory muscle strength and pulmonary function that we hypothesize will correlate to improved functional performance and quality of life post-liver transplant. Pre-test post-test design, that will randomize subjects into an experimental group that will receive the inspiratory muscle strengthening exercise in addition to usual post-liver transplant care and a control group that will only receive the usual post-transplant care. Up to 50 subjects will be recruited from the Post-Liver Transplant Outpatient Clinic at the Miami Transplant Institute. The subjects will have repeated measurements of respiratory muscle strength, pulmonary function, functional mobility performance, and quality of life at baseline, 4 weeks, and 8 weeks.

A Continuation Study to Assess the Effect of CellCept in Patients With Myasthenia Gravis.

Myasthenia Gravis Generalised

This 2 arm study will provide optional continuation of double-blind treatment with CellCept or placebo, in patients with myasthenia gravis who have achieved good symptom control in study WX17798. Patients who have completed 36 weeks of treatment in study WX17798, with stable prednisone dosing for the last 4 weeks, can continue on blinded treatment with CellCept (1g bid) or placebo until the database for WX17798 is locked and unblinded. The anticipated time on study treatment is 3-12 months, and the target sample size is 100-500 individuals.

Ultrasound Guided Adductor Canal Block Versus Femoral Nerve Block for Quadriceps Strength and Fall-risk...

Quadriceps Muscle WeaknessAdductor Muscle Weakness1 more

Our objective was to determine if an ultrasound guided ACB can preserve quadriceps strength, thus minimizing weakness of knee extension compared with ultrasound guided femoral nerve block. Our primary outcome was the percent of maximum voluntary isometric contraction (MVIC) of knee extension preserved at 30 mins after either an ACB or FNB. Secondary outcomes included MVIC of knee extension at 60 min, hip adduction at 30 and 60 mins, and assessment of fall risk with the Berg Balance Scale (BBS) at 30 minutes.

Mirror Neurons in Older Participants

Muscle WeaknessDynapenia1 more

A critical problem facing aging adults is muscle weakness. Whereas scientists have traditionally attributed the loss of muscle strength with aging to muscle atrophy, emerging evidence suggests that impairments in the neuromuscular system's ability to voluntarily generate force plays a more central role than previously appreciated. One area that has not yet been investigated includes the role that observing another's actions - thereby activating mirror neurons - plays in muscle force generation. Therefore, the purpose of this study is to examine the acute effects of action observation on muscular strength, voluntary muscle activation, and cortical excitability and inhibition in older adults.

7T Magnetic Resonance Spectroscopy and Skeletal Muscle Biopsy Findings in Statin Associated Adverse...

Muscle CrampAche3 more

Over 40 million Americans take statins to reduce their risk of atherosclerotic cardiovascular disease (ASCVD). Unfortunately, 10 to 20% stop taking them due to statin-associated muscle symptoms (e.g. pain, aches, weakness, cramps, or stiffness) (1, 2). The pathophysiology of these statin-associated muscle symptoms (SAMS) has remained elusive. Consequently, no objective diagnostic method exists, causing confusion for patient and providers since muscle symptoms can often be multifactorial.

Stretching Techniques of Knee Muscles and Their Effect on Joint Range, Suppleness and Muscle Activity...

Muscle TightnessMuscle Weakness

The goal of this clinical trial was to compare the effect of two different types of stretching techniques in elderly population. The main questions it aims to answer are: What is the immediate effect (after a single intervention) of these stretching techniques on muscle flexibility, amount of knee joint motion and muscle activity? What is the effect of a four week intervention program of these stretching techniques on muscle flexibility, amount of knee joint motion and muscle activity? There were three groups with ten randomly allocated participants in each group. Intervention group I was given a stretching technique called contract-relax technique and the Intervention group II was given static stretching. The third group was not given any treatment and was taken as a control. The main aim was to find out that whether the two techniques are effective or not and which one of the two is better than the other in terms of improvement in the above mentioned parameters.

Probiotic-Muscle Study

Old Age; DebilityMuscle Weakness2 more

This study will examine the effect of probiotic supplementation (Bacillus coagulans) on muscle protein synthesis in older adults in response to a plant-based diet. The investigators hypothesize that probiotic supplementation will enhance the digestibility of plant protein, therefore increasing the proportion of ingested amino acids that appear in systemic circulation and enhancing rates of muscle protein synthesis.

Effect of Texting and Writing on Grip and Pinch Strength

Muscle Weakness ConditionHand Grasp

Texting and writing are common hand activities among college students. Students tend to spend increasing hours of texting and writing for every day activities in addition to the academic assignments that are mainly on line and through distance education. The effect of such daily activities on hand grip and key pinch strength has not been studied among college students.
